Chile's Under 20 National Team managed its third straight victory in the South American qualifying tournament for this year's U20 World Cup with a 2-1 victory over Colombia, despite playing two-men down at the end of the game.

Chile's goals were scored by Cristian Cuevas and Igor Lichnovsky, while Colombia scored through Juan Fernando Quintero from the penalty spot.

With the victory, the team from the Andean country which is coached by Mario Salas automatically qualified for the hexagonal final, the last stage of qualifying for the tournament which will be held in Turkey.

Having already defeated host Argentina and Bolivia, Chile is first with 9 points.

The qualifying tournament is divided in to two groups of five teams, with the first three teams of each groups qualifying for the hexagonal phase. In that phase, all qualified teams will play each other with the top four going to the World Cup.
